In our Paris to Belgrade EV duel, the Audi A6 Sportback e-tron performance beats the Audi Q6 e-tron performance by 17 minutes, completing the 1771km route in 17h 17min. The key advantage? 1 fewer charging stop. Route calculated on September 5, 2026 using real-time charging station data.
The Audi A6 Sportback e-tron performance needs only 5 charging stops compared to 6 for the slowest vehicle, saving valuable time.

Why the Audi A6 Sportback e-tron performance Won
The Audi A6 Sportback e-tron performance achieved a 17-minute advantage over Audi Q6 e-tron performance on this 1771km route. Key factors:
- Fewer charging stops: 5 stops vs 6 for the slowest vehicle means less time spent finding and connecting to chargers.
- Faster charging: Total charging time of 54min vs 1h 11min thanks to higher peak charging speeds or better charging curve.
- Better efficiency: Lower energy consumption (~276 kWh vs ~325 kWh) means less time spent charging.
